South Korea's GS Caltex Plans to Kick Off $62 Million in Projects in 2021, an Industrial Info Market Brief
GS Caltex Corporation, one of South Korea's largest petroleum Refiners, in South Korea, plans to kick off 22 plant maintenance, unit addition, upgrade and environmental compliance projects, worth more than $62 million, in 2021.
